Tim had a one-man wood working shop. His son, Arnie was his only helper. Tim asked me to help with a problem. The debt and bills were piled high. Tim didn’t know what to do or where to turn. To make things worse, Tim’s health was failing. We needed a plan.

First, we tightened up on receivables to get some cash flow. This bought time and some much-needed relief. Then we looked at expenses and started cutting back. It didn’t seem like much, but it put the business into the black.

Then I got Tim to secure a life insurance policy naming Arnie as the beneficiary. This was a key step in creating some peace of mind. Tim knew Arnie would be OK.
